These clear wide bioplastic lids are made from plants, not oil and fits our 600 & 700ml clear Wide BioBowls. Note: For cold use only. PLA softens in higher temperatures. Store below 35°C and out of direct sunlight. Refer to our PLA Care Guide.

Category Details

  • BioPak clear bowls may look and perform like any other plastic bowls, but ours are made from Ingeo™, a plant-based bioplastic.
  • Using Ingeo™ reduces raw material CO2 emissions by 75% compared to regular plastic resin.
  • These clear bowls are certified commercially compostable to Australian AS 4736 standards and European EN 13432 standards.
  • Suitable for serving cold meals like salads.
  • Bioplastics must be stored out of direct sun and below 35°C. If stored correctly, they have an indefinite shelf life. Bioplastic does not have suitable oxygen barrier properties to store food for more than a few days.

Environmental Impact Label

Clear and accurate data is essential to understanding our impact on the environment and finding solutions to reduce it. The label below shows how a carton of this product impacts our planet. As a leader in sustainable packaging, this label is our way of being transparent, accountable, and committed to combating greenwashing.

The eco-cost calculated per carton, offers our customers a straightforward metric to understand and compare the environmental impacts of our products. Please note that it is not a hidden or added fee to the product's market price.

The eco-cost is independently calculated across four categories – biodiversity loss, effects on human health, material scarcity, as well as the more standard carbon emissions. BioPak utilises this data to identify areas with the greatest potential for environmental impact reduction, it is our job to reduce the eco-cost and your impact.
